Market Overview and Introduction
Industrial access management plays a crucial role in protecting corporate property, intellectual assets, and employee safety. These systems are built for demanding environments, using ruggedized components designed to withstand dust, moisture, and extreme temperatures common in heavy industry. The market includes a wide range of hardware, such as heavy-duty turnstiles, electronic smart locks, and multi-technology readers, all managed by centralized software. When combined, these tools allow facility managers to control entry points, track movements, and maintain accurate digital logs for security audits and regulatory compliance.

Key Growth Drivers
A primary driver of this market trend is the rising demand for strict workplace safety compliance. Industrial facilities operate under stringent regulations that require keeping untrained personnel away from high-risk machinery and hazardous materials. Additionally, protecting high-value equipment and proprietary operational processes is essential for maintaining production schedules. Internal theft, asset damage, or corporate espionage can halt production lines and lead to severe financial losses. Implementing automated entry systems allows companies to minimize human error, reduce liability, and keep production moving safely.

Regional Insights and Preferences
Regional priorities vary across the global landscape based on local regulations and technology adoption. In North America, companies focus on cloud-based systems and advanced Door Security Systems to manage multiple facilities from a single platform. In Western Europe, strict data privacy standards drive demand for access solutions that ensure highly secure data handling and comply with regional privacy rules. Meanwhile, across the Asia-Pacific region, rapid industrial expansion and infrastructure projects create strong demand for durable, cost-effective physical barriers and scalable electronic readers.
